The Hi-Tech Diamond 6″ Lapidary Saw is an American-made, versatile bench-top tool designed for cutting and trimming rocks, minerals, glass, and stones. It ships with two 6″ diamond blades tailored to different materials, enabling quick material changes without swapping setups. The machine’s 1/4 HP direct-drive motor provides an adjustable speed range from 800 to 3,400 RPM, balancing speed and control for precise cuts. A coolant reservoir helps maintain blade performance and material integrity during longer sessions. With a compact 15-lb frame and rust-resistant housing, it’s suitable for table-top workbenches and portable setups.

The Hi-Tech Diamond 10″ Slab Saw is designed to convert large rocks and minerals into manageable slabs. Equipped with two 10″ diamond blades, this American-made machine handles notches for slabs, while the included sintered and notched blades cut glass and quartz with ease. The 1/3 HP motor delivers up to 1,725 RPM, delivering substantial cutting power for thicker rocks and geodes. Its 224-ounce water reservoir and splash guard minimize splashback, making it friendlier for long sessions. The rigid, rustproof polyethylene housing protects the motor and supports stable cutting on tabletops or workbenches.

Highlights include: compatibility with any 10″ blade with a 5/8″ arbor, a deep coolant reservoir, and a compact footprint for slab work. The slab saw’s table measures 19-3/4″ by 12″ and provides ample room for larger rock slabs, making it suitable for geodes, agates, and larger lapidary projects where slab precision matters.

Buying Guide: Wet Saws For Rocks

Across these options, several factors influence performance for rock cutting. Consider blade diameter and type, motor power, and water management to optimize heat control and cut quality. Here are the main angles to evaluate:

  • Blade compatibility: Check blade diameters (6″ vs 10″ vs 7″), arbor size, and whether the saw accepts multiple blade types for different rock textures, glass, or geodes.
  • Cutting depth and table space: Larger rocks require deeper cuts and more table room. Slab saws offer expansive work surfaces; tile and small-lab saws fit compact setups.
  • Motor power and speed control: Higher wattage and RPM provide faster cuts but may demand more heat management. Look for adjustable speeds for delicate materials.
  • Water cooling and particulates: A reliable coolant system minimizes blade wear and reduces dust, improving indoor use and operator safety.
  • Stability and portability: Rigid housings and splash guards improve accuracy. Lighter machines are easier to move but may compromise stability for larger stones.
  • Maintenance and accessories: Included blades, splash guards, and reservoirs reduce setup time. Ensure replacement blades and parts are readily available.

In practice, choose a system that matches your typical rock sizes, geode dimensions, and preferred finishes. If you frequently slab large rocks, a 10″ or larger slab saw with dual blades and a sturdy base is ideal. For smaller, hobbyist projects, a compact 6″ lapidary saw with dual blades offers good flexibility and portability. Always operate with proper safety gear, and follow manufacturer guidelines for blade types and water usage.
